Bria Brooks is an intelligent, charming, cunning new doctoral student. She’s also a serial killer. She’s got her eyes on her next target, Caron Berger, a cult leader.
Dr. Elijah Kaplan, a professor of forensic psychology, (a ridiculously hot 30 something year old professor), has his eye on the same target.
These two will do whatever it takes (by VERY different methods) to see this man brought to the end of his reign.
When our two MCs cross paths everything dark in Bria calls out to Eli, and he finds himself battling to do what’s right versus what he really wants.

Ever since reading Butcher and Blackbird I knew I needed to read more of Brynne's work...and Black Sheep did not disappoint. This is definitely darker than Butcher and Blackbird...nothing romcom-y about it. So just know that going in ^^
When I first started reading I was a little worried I wouldn't connect to Bria but as her many layers begin to peel back...I not only connected, I related too, and fiercely wanted to support and protect.
Though the first have of the book did feel a little slow [in the thriller/mystery aspect of the story...the spice was spicing don't worry haha] the last half I could not put down and ended up reading into the wee hours to finish.
Though the story ended I could easily see a spin off happen and I would not be disappointed if that happened ^^
